I found the Manay free cd set offer site and elected to send for the set and pay $4.95 s&h. I scrolled thru the terms of agreement but did not read the 11,000 word document assuming it was a basic software disclosure. I clicked I agree to terms and there the nightmare begins.

Apparently, somewhere near the 17th paragraph, the terms sign you up for unlimited cds mailed to your home at a cost of $19.95 each. Also, the free cd set you send for is not 4 cds as shown. They send you 4 but only 2 are free. If you don't send back two of them, they will charge you $19.95 each. The 10 day trial that was not evident on the website began and ended before you ever receive the discs so you have to pay for the other two even if you send them back. Their claim is valid since you signed the terms of agreement.

All disputes are for naught since you clicked you agreed to terms. Let the buyer beware. I received the discs yesterday and the charges are on my account today. I submitted to cancel and they advised since the 10 day trial was past that I need do nothing, the complete 4 cd set was mine to keep. Even at this stage they have not informed me that they had charged my account. I know they have only because I checked and the charge is not disputable. I agreed to terms. Gotcha.

It is all very deceptive and misleading. If nothing else, I have purchased $40.00 worth of wisdom about putting my credit card out there for a less than honest business.
